摘 要:干凝胶作为一种新型的轻质多孔材料在工业生产和人们的生活中具有广泛的应用,但是其较低的强度和易碎裂的特点却限制了其实际应用。结合干凝胶的制备过程,总结了几种有效的降低结构破坏的途径,并对其机理做了简要分析,最后对干凝胶的应用前景做了展望。As a new low - density and porous material, xerogel is wildly used in industry producing and people' s life, but its application has been limited by its harmful features , such as low - strength and fragileness. Associated with the preparing process of xerogel, several effective ways to reduce the structural damage has been generalized, and the mechanism has also been analysed simply, and the application of xerogel has been prospected at last.
